A Farmer's Journey To Immortality

"Battling young masters for some treasures in mysterious caves? No, thank you. What's so special about a ring containing an old sage's trapped soul? I'll just toss it away. Becoming a direct disciple of some big expert with many enemies? Count me out. I'll flip the bird to the pointless struggle in prestigious sects that only attract calamity. What I have here, this opportunity I've seized, is plenty for me. I'll choose safe and steady methods of progress, even if they're slow. After all, I'm just a simple farmer seeking peace through cultivation. I'll rely on myself to pave the way." - Aksai Everwood (Chapter 7) ============ Meet Aksai Everwood, a guy who thought he was done with life, but life had other plans. Aksai wasn't always Aksai. He used to be Arman Arlott, a terminally ill dude who decided to take one last wild ride before checking out. Little did he know, a crazy experiment would flip his world upside down. Arman's mind got tangled up with artificial intelligence, and things got seriously weird. Instead of peacefully bowing out, Arman ended up sacrificing himself for some mind-blowing breakthrough. But instead of eternal rest, he got a second chance as Aksai Everwood, a spirit farmer in a new world. Talk about a cosmic curveball! You'd think being a farmer in a serene, pastoral paradise would be easy, right? Nope. Aksai's new world is anything but peaceful. Farming is far from sunshine and rainbows here. Aksai dreams of a chill life cultivating his crops, but in the wild world of immortal cultivation, peace is a rare commodity. Luckily, Aksai's got some serious advantages. He's got a neural link fabric that makes him a whiz at alchemy and array formations, giving him a leg up on other Spirit cultivators. Plus, he has the Enchanted Everwood Farm, a magical place where he can grow all sorts of mysterious cultivation resources with awesome bonuses. This farm comes with perks that make Aksai a one-of-a-kind Spirit farmer. And here's the kicker: the farm is suspended in a spatial junction of all existing realities. That means Aksai can hop between different worlds as he levels up in his Spirit cultivation. With these unique advantages, Aksai ditches the traditional path of joining a sect or a renowned clan. Instead, he explores various worlds, using their unique resources and methods to forge his own path as a Spirit cultivator. What do myriad worlds unlock? A druid bloodline, body cultivation, martial arts, and lots more. Who’d join sects when given such perks? The stage is set for our Spirit farmer. About a minute or so after Aksai retreated to the Everwood farmland, a fourth person indeed appeared and looked around himself in irritation.

This was a 7th-stage Spirit Refiner man.

"Where did those two idiots and that woman run off along with the target? Did they decide to play hide and seek with him?"

He thought to himself and then sighed as if this was the first time it had happened. 

"Hm? Wait… something's not adding up here."

However, he looked carefully at the surroundings and realized that a fight had taken place there. The residual Spirit fluctuations of spells were still in the surroundings.

A few tiny stray flames left behind by Aksai's fire-type Spirit spell were still quietly dancing on the ground, slowly losing their potency and fading into nothingness.

The newly appeared man's name was Zen Pewlu, and he was one of the main retainers of Lian Lakir. He was a tall man with a lean build and sharp eyes. He wore milky white robes that stuck to his body and highlighted the fact that he didn't have much muscular definition.

However, Zen's breath as the 7th stage Spirit Refiner couldn't be questioned. Since he had been in this stage for quite a few years, his presence was much stronger than Aksai who was also at the same cultivation level as him.

Zen also had broader battle experience than the masked woman. Aksai wouldn't have been able to kill this man if he had to fight Zen upfront. At Aksai's best, he could merely manage to get away with using the oil painting after suffering various critical injuries. And at its worst, Aksai would have died at Zen's hands.

The actual battle between Aksai and the trio of cultivators only lasted for less than a minute. Aksai almost left immediately after that. There was not much commotion caused by the fight, as Aksai had taken care of the two cultivators at the very start of the battle.

Thus, Zen wasn't aware that the three-person team Lian had sent in order to pursue Aksai and check his battle skills had already been wiped out. He waited quietly for a few minutes outside the alley, expecting either the three people or Aksai himself to come out of the alley and run into him in the process.

However, when he sensed that the alley up ahead was too quiet, Zen decided to check up on the progress. Unlike the masked trio, this man was only supposed to act as a backup and not involve himself in a frontal clash. As such, he had no intentions to take an active part in the battle if he were to run into one.

"What happened to those three?" Zen mumbled as he carefully looked around. A grim picture was painted in front of him as he sensed everything using his elementary Spirit Sense.

"The target killed those three and took away their bodies? Did he have a space storage artifact on him? The report didn't mention any of this."

Zen questioned himself as he followed the fake trail left behind by Aksai intentionally. Using the Advanced Light Steps talisman, he climbed over the long walls, abandoned houses, and dilapidated ceilings at the other end of the alley before stopping his search. 

"The trail ends here. I don't know where he went off to after this point."

Zen's expressions darkened when he realized that all of them, including Lian, had underestimated their target.

"Even Nesha was killed? How can this be?"

Zen was ready to accept the fact that Aksai killed the two subordinates the masked woman Nesha had. However, even he had to acknowledge the masked woman's strength and skills.

She was younger than him and only a few steps away from breaking into the 7th stage of the Spirit Refining realm. With Lian's consistent support and her own talent, she was guaranteed to reach Spirit Refining Perfection in the future. There was no way a cultivator supposedly in the 5th stage of the same realm could defeat her.

"Haah! Nesha died without getting the chance to visit the inheritance grounds. I'm sure Master Lian is not going to like this," Zen said as he pressed his forehead and temples with his fingers. He seemed to have a headache at the thought of reporting these findings to Lian.

After all, the masked woman's identity was a bit special in Lian's eyes. And he knew that Lian wouldn't be able to sit still after finding out about the masked woman's death.

However, Zen had to do what he was hired to do. He soon reported everything to Lian, including his on-field findings.

A glass of wine was smashed onto the ground in rage by Lian after hearing that Nesha had died. It seemed that Nesha was more important in Lian's eyes than she had initially thought when she was alive.

"Who… who was that man? Take a few Blood Bakshis with you and find out. I want to know everything about him." Lian said coldly, regaining his composure. It was as if the one who broke the glass wasn't him.

Lian's previous refined attitude was regained in a few breaths. Zen nodded before going back to the abandoned alley with a few mysterious cultivators in his tow.

These mysterious cultivators known as Blood Bakshis were associated with the Lakir family. They wore dark red robes and were part of the Lakir family's hidden force. They were skilled in using demonic and dark arts. However, since Aksai had not left a trace of his being on the kill site, they weren't able to find anything about him.

All of this progress spanned over about five hours. Aksai didn't try to come back to the real world during this time.

After all, he could only reappear at the place where he was previously using the oil painting. He'd be immediately confronted by the Lakir family's forces if he ran into them at that time.

During this time, the abandoned back alley had unwittingly become a center of attraction because of the Lakir family's unusual activities inside it. It would be foolish for Aksai to return to his "crime scene" anytime soon.

Blood Bakshi cultivators conveyed to Lian that they faced challenges in tracking Aksai for several reasons. Nevertheless, they successfully crafted a black bead designed to change color to red in the presence of Aksai.

The range of the bead detection was limited to a mere 10 meters and the accuracy was somewhat questionable. However, this was already the best the Blood Bakshi could do using their heretic methods.

Accepting the bead from the Blood Bakshi cultivators, Lian dismissed them and held the bead in his palm for a while, his gaze fixed upon it.

Closing his fist, he murmured, "I will avenge you, Nesha. Just wait," while peering outside the window.
